CVE-2018-14795 is a vulnerability of currently unknown severity. DeltaV Versions 11.3.1, 12.3.1, 13.3.0, 13.3.1, and R5 is vulnerable due to improper path validation which may allow an attacker to replace executable files.. EPSS estimates a 2.19% chance of exploitation in the next 30 days.

Description

DeltaV Versions 11.3.1, 12.3.1, 13.3.0, 13.3.1, and R5 is vulnerable due to improper path validation which may allow an attacker to replace executable files.
